    There are several different types of life insurance policies available, each offering its own unique benefits and features life insurance a. Term life insurance is a popular option that provides coverage for a specified period of time, typically ranging from 10 to 30 years This type of policy is often the most affordable option and can be a good choice for individuals who only need coverage for a limited period of time.

    Permanent life insurance, on the other hand, provides coverage for your entire life as long as you continue to pay the premiums This type of policy also includes a cash value component that can grow over time While permanent life insurance tends to be more expensive than term life insurance, it can provide lifelong financial protection and can also serve as an investment vehicle.

  • Understanding Empty Rates Mitigation: Strategies For Success

    empty rates mitigation refers to the practice of reducing or minimizing the business rates payable on empty properties. In the UK, business rates are charged on most non-domestic properties, including those that are vacant. This can create a significant financial burden for property owners, particularly during times of economic downturn or when properties are difficult to let or sell.

    To combat this issue, many property owners and operators employ various strategies to mitigate the impact of empty rates on their bottom line. These strategies can include taking advantage of exemptions and reliefs, engaging in active management of vacant properties, and exploring alternative uses for empty spaces. By effectively implementing these tactics, property owners can minimize the financial strain of empty rates and ensure that their properties remain profitable.

    One of the most common ways to mitigate empty rates is to take advantage of the exemptions and reliefs that are available to property owners. For example, properties that are undergoing major structural repairs or are being redeveloped may be eligible for relief from empty rates for a certain period of time. Similarly, properties that are classified as small business premises or are part of a rural enterprise may qualify for reduced rates or exemptions altogether.

    By staying informed about the various exemptions and reliefs that are available, property owners can ensure that they are not paying more in empty rates than necessary. This can help to minimize the financial impact of vacant properties and allow owners to focus on finding new tenants or buyers for their spaces.

  • The Importance Of Good Biosecurity: Protecting Our Health And Economy

    In today’s interconnected world, the threat of disease outbreaks is more significant than ever before. From animal diseases like avian flu to human pandemics like COVID-19, the consequences of not having effective biosecurity measures in place can be devastating. That’s why it is crucial to understand the benefits of good biosecurity and the role it plays in protecting our health, economy, and environment.

    Biosecurity refers to the measures put in place to prevent the introduction and spread of harmful organisms, such as viruses, bacteria, parasites, and invasive species. While often associated with agriculture and animal husbandry, biosecurity is relevant across various sectors, including healthcare, tourism, and transportation. By implementing sound biosecurity practices, individuals and organizations can reduce the risk of disease outbreaks, minimize economic losses, and safeguard biodiversity.

    One of the primary benefits of good biosecurity is the prevention of disease outbreaks. By implementing robust biosecurity protocols, such as regular cleaning and disinfection, quarantines, and restricted access measures, the spread of pathogens can be significantly reduced. This not only protects the health and well-being of humans and animals but also helps prevent the economic impact of disease outbreaks. For example, in the agricultural sector, biosecurity measures can prevent the spread of diseases like foot-and-mouth disease or African swine fever, which can devastate livestock populations and lead to significant financial losses for farmers and producers.

    In addition to preventing disease outbreaks, good biosecurity can also help protect the environment and preserve biodiversity. Invasive species, such as the emerald ash borer or the Asian carp, can wreak havoc on ecosystems and threaten native species. By implementing biosecurity measures, such as the inspection and sterilization of imported goods, these harmful organisms can be prevented from entering new environments and causing ecological damage. Moreover, biosecurity measures play a critical role in protecting endangered species and habitats from the threat of disease transmission.

  • Understanding The Concept Of Vertical Laminar Flow

    vertical laminar flow, often used in cleanrooms and laboratories, is a controlled airflow mechanism that helps maintain a sterile and dust-free environment. In this article, we will delve into the details of vertical laminar flow, its applications, benefits, and how it works.

    vertical laminar flow is a type of air filtration system that directs air in a straight, uniform direction from the ceiling to the floor. The airflow moves in a vertical direction, creating a “curtain” of clean air that establishes a clean zone within the room. This airflow pattern prevents contaminants from entering the clean zone, thus maintaining a high level of cleanliness and sterility.

    One of the primary applications of vertical laminar flow is in cleanrooms, which are controlled environments used in industries such as pharmaceuticals, biotechnology, electronics, and healthcare. Cleanrooms require stringent cleanliness standards to prevent contamination of products or experiments. vertical laminar flow helps maintain these standards by providing a continuous flow of filtered air that removes particles and contaminants from the environment.

    Laboratories also benefit from vertical laminar flow systems, especially in areas where sensitive experiments or procedures are being conducted. By creating a clean zone with controlled airflow, vertical laminar flow minimizes the risk of contamination and ensures the accuracy and reliability of experimental results.

    The key components of a vertical laminar flow system include a high-efficiency particulate air (HEPA) or ultralow penetration air (ULPA) filter, a fan or blower, and a duct system that directs the filtered air in a vertical direction. The HEPA or ULPA filter captures particles as small as 0.3 microns, removing dust, bacteria, viruses, and other contaminants from the air.

    The fan or blower creates the airflow that pushes the filtered air through the filter and directs it vertically into the room. The duct system helps distribute the filtered air evenly across the clean zone, ensuring uniform airflow throughout the space.
